Osci tlm 2 user manual

Tap create new pattern to add a preset pattern onto osci 2. This document is for information and instruction purposes. The instruction set simulators generated by trap are based on the osci systemc 2. External ports are implemented according to the osci tlm 2. This document is the user manual for the osci transaction level modeling standard, version 2. International specialist seminar on the design and application of parallel digital processors, 1115 apr 1988. Vhdl overview, the general structure of the language ii. Building a loosely timed soc model with osci tlm 2. Sep 15, 2017 hecras is an integrated system of software, designed for interactive use in a multitasking, multi user network environment. Below you will find a brief video outlining the main features of the tlm 2. Standards are developed in a collaborative and open environment by technical working groups. This version of the standard includes the core interfaces from tlm 1.

Tap adjust levels to adjust the first three levels. Over the next few months we will be adding more developer resources and documentation for all the products and technologies that arm provides. This version of the standard includes the core interfaces from tlm1. After successfully pairing osci to your phone, tap on the osci panel in the my toys section. In this article we take a look at the new features of tlm 2. Data sheet and users manual ad10 bssc20001 issue 1.

Mentor graphics reserves the right to make changes in specifications and other information contained in this. The system is comprised of a graphical user interface gui, separate hydraulic analysis components, data storage and management capabilities, graphics and reporting facilities. Ieee std 16662005, systemc language reference manual, 31 march 2006 osci, tlm 2. Transmitting tlm transactions over analogue wire models. Ja32, july, 2009 spacewire codec ip user manual the user manual of the rtl ip core provides grounds for the utilisation. The lrm provides the definitive statement of the semantics of systemc. Development of spacewire and can systemc transaction. Tap create new pattern to add a preset pattern onto osci. After studying, you should be able to use the full functionality of the module. The latest achievements in this area are mostly due to wide systemc adoption and the recent introduction of the tlm 2.

This document is the reference manual for the osci transaction level modeling standard, version 2. Inclusion of the open systemc initiative tlm1 and tlm 2 modeling standards into the ieee 1666 systemc lrm. Analyzing variable entanglement for parallel simulation of. However the osci reference implementation lacks training material and examples to introduce new users to the technology. Depending on the desired accuracyspeed tradeoff, the model can target either the exchange or the packet protocol levels as described in the ecss standard. University of tehran school of electrical and computer.

This version of the standard supersedes versions 2. The development of systemc as a standard for modeling hardware started in 1996. Configuration and control of systemc models using tlm. Accellera approves universal verification methodology uvm. In this paper, we analyze two basic approaches to hls user input that exist today sequential ansi. However the osci reference implementation lacks training material and.

The middleware uses a generic transaction passing mechanism based on tlm 2 concepts and provides interoperability between the different configuration interfaces in a heterogeneous design. Craven, highlevel abstractions and modular debugging for fpga design validation. The following publications provide reference information about systemc and the tlm 2. Part i of this document defines the use cases for transaction level modeling, and highlights the areas that are is the scope of the 2. Vhdl in a topdown processor design 4 using systemc university of tehran school of electrical and computer engineering.

It proposed its first standard for transaction level modeling in 2005. At the 45th design automation conference in june 2008, the open systemc initiative osci announced the ratification of the tlm 2. A systemc superset for highlevel synthesis springerlink. Arms developer website includes documentation, tutorials, support resources and more. Osci has several groups working on supplementary standards. Depending on the desired accuracysimulation speed tradeoff, different flavors of. Without a containment construct, simulation threads are permitted to directly access data of other modules and that. Hecras is an integrated system of software, designed for interactive use in a multitasking, multiuser network environment. Introduction currently, transaction level modeling is being used in the industry to solve a variety of practical problems during the design, development and deployment of electronic systems. This ipcore consists of a systemc model, described at transactional level, of such spwb codec.

Configuration and control of systemc models using tlm middleware. This session we will talk about the osci systemc tlm2. This class was developed by the authors of the ieee 1666 systemc language reference manual and the tlm 2. The paper analyses configuration in general and explains the technical consideration for our middleware and shows how it makes the stateoftheart. Development of new systemc ip models and ocpip sockets. Some slides and phrases are taken from osci documentation available at. Systemc language reference manual the institute of electrical and electronics engineers, inc. Depending on the desired accuracysimulation speed tradeoff, different flavors of simulators can be created. Bridging the gap between queuingbased performance evaluation and systemc.

Part ii of the document defines detailed implementation requirements for the osci tlm 2. Systemc is defined and promoted by the open systemc initiative osci now accellera, and has been approved by the ieee standards association as ieee 16662011 the systemc language reference manual lrm. Working groups operate by building consensus regarding requirements, proposed new features, and implementation. After successfully pairing osci 2 to your phone, tap on the osci 2 panel in the my toys section. The complexity of todays soc designs makes highlevel synthesis hls an important part of modern design flows. The manual describes the functionality and limit of module use. The ambapv extension is a mandatory extension for the modelling of amba buses. Tlm 2 draft 2 requirements designed for use with ieee std. Development of spacewire and can systemc transaction level. File list here is a list of all documented files with brief descriptions. Grateful acknowledgment is made to the open systemc initiative osci for the permission to use the following source material.

659 85 15 984 409 1532 645 38 725 1320 1123 1085 72 731 1335 750 1583 191 600 421 1443 573 1262 957 1673 1184 462 1170 737 836 328 1266 1338 410 1194 427 1608 945 201 863 1131 314 1324 629 221 1067 508 381